Larissa Bonfante
Larissa Bonfante was an Italian-American classicist, Professor of Classics emerita at New York University and an authority on Etruscan language and culture.

André Pinçon
André Pinçon was a French politician who served as Mayor of Laval from 1973 to 1994.
Gérard Kango Ouédraogo
Gérard Kango Ouédraogo was a Burkinabé statesman and diplomat who served as Prime Minister of Upper Volta from 13 February 1971 to 8 February 1974. He was subsequently President of the National Assembly of Burkina Faso from October 1978 to November 25, 1980.
Peter Handford
Peter Handford was an English location sound recordist. He is considered a master and pioneer of this area of sound recording.

Jule Styne
Jule Styne was a British-American songwriter and composer best known for a series of Broadway musicals, including several famous frequently-revived shows that also became successful films: Gypsy, Gentlemen Prefer Blondes, and Funny Girl.
Karin Nellemose
Karin Nellemose, was a Danish actress in the theatre and in Danish cinema. She was the sister of sculptor Knud Nellemose (1908–1997). In Matador she plays a significant role as the confused spinster Misse Møhge.
Ann E. Todd
Ann E. Todd was an American child actress. As an adult, she became a music reference librarian at University of California, Berkeley.
